It's less expensive to engage a car accident lawyer than you think. Most lawyers do not charge clients an upfront fee. Instead, they operate on a contingency fee basis and earn a portion of the settlement they secure for their clients. The laws of your state and local legal market will determine whether your lawyer is working on an hourly basis. However the best rule of thumb is to get 33 percent of the settlement.

The cost of hiring a car accident lawyer might be one of most pressing issues facing car accident victims. Fortunately most lawyers work on the basis of contingency, which means that you don't have to pay up-front for anything. You pay your lawyer on contingency fees if they win, and then you reimburse them from the amount they recover for you. Get medical attention immediately if you're injured in a car crash. Although you may feel anxious and anxious, it's recommended that you remain calm until emergency medical assistance arrives. It is vital to seek medical attention promptly following an accident. Some injuries might not be apparent immediately. Additionally the adrenaline rush that comes with the accident can make it easier to manage pain, and delay in treatment could aggravate your health. In addition, if you fail to seek treatment, car accident lawyer the jury may find your injury to be less serious than you claim and may hurt your chances of winning a lawsuit.
